Popped in for petrol yesterday and got 22 liters of 98 using the pay at pump option. Pressed for a receipt but no joy. Hey ho, it was busy so rode away. Checked the bank account today and I was charged £44.80. :eek: IIrc the pump price was £1.28. It's now in the hands of the bank to sort out.

So pay at the counter folks, it's less hassle in the long run!

Did you pay by card?

Theres been a glitch in some card payment transactions and loads have people have been billed once but charged twice. All the big banks are aware and will be refunding accordingly

At some Stations, if a pump is out of paper, or the printer is jammed, you can insert the same card at an adjacent pump to get your receipt. Saves going to the counter, if there is a queue.
